likgeom: Geometric Log Likelihood Function

Description

The log likelihood of a geometric density with data, x, prob parameter.

Usage

likgeom(x, prob, log = TRUE)

Arguments

x

vector of quantiles representing the number of failures in a sequence of Bernoulli trials before success occurs.

prob

probability of success in each trial. 0 < prob <= 1.

log

logical; if TRUE, probabilities p are given as log(p).

Value

A numeric scalar for the log likelihood of the geometric density given the data where prob can be held constant or if vector were given vector will be returned.

Details

The log likelihood is the log of a function of parameters given the data.
